Impact crusher machines are commonly used in mining, construction, and demolition industries to crush and break materials. The machine uses a high-speed impact force to crush materials into smaller pieces. However, various factors can affect the performance of impact crusher machines. In this article, we will discuss some of the critical factors that can influence the performance of impact crusher machines.
Material Properties:
One of the significant factors that influence the performance of impact crusher for sale is the properties of the material being crushed. The hardness, abrasiveness, and moisture content of the material can affect the machine’s ability to crush it. Harder and more abrasive materials require higher impact forces, which can cause wear and tear on the machine’s components. Moisture in the material can also affect the machine’s performance by causing clogging or sticking.
Rotor Speed:
Another critical factor that can affect the performance of impact crusher machines is the rotor speed. The rotor speed determines the amount of impact force that the machine can produce. Higher rotor speeds can generate more impact force, which can result in better crushing efficiency. However, excessive rotor speed can also cause the jaw crusher machine to vibrate, which can lead to mechanical failure.
Feed Size:
The size of the material being fed into the impact crusher machine is also an essential factor that can affect its performance. Larger materials require more significant impact force to break down, while smaller materials may not require as much force. It is essential to ensure that the machine’s feed size is within its design limits to prevent mechanical failure or reduced performance.
Feed Rate:
The feed rate of the material into the impact crusher machine is another critical factor that can affect its performance. The feed rate determines the amount of material that enters the machine per unit of time. If the feed rate is too high, the machine may become overloaded, which can cause mechanical failure or reduced performance. Maintenance:
Regular maintenance is crucial to ensure that the impact crusher machine operates at peak performance. Lack of maintenance can cause wear and tear on the machine’s components, which can lead to mechanical failure. Regular maintenance includes checking the machine’s components for wear and tear, lubricating moving parts, and replacing worn components.
